Online Video Poker Tutorial: Game Play

Online Video Poker TutorialThe game starts as players place their desires stakes. For online video poker, players choose a coin by clicking on the screen of the game. Once the player places the wager, he then to click the button that says “Deal.”

Players will get a poker hand consists of 5 cards and can decide which ones to hold and which to discard. To hold a card, you may click the cards itself or a “Hold” button under the card. Once done, players will click on “Draw.”

Replacement cards are given to players randomly for the ones discarded from the first 5-card poker hand. Players will then paid according to the paytable of the game and the bet placed at the beginning.

Online Video Poker Tutorial: Basic Rules

Video poker follows the same hand ranking as regular poker with Royal Flush being the highest hand. Also, in video poker, it is the hand that matters regardless of the value of the cards forming it. For example, a pair of Aces will have the same pay for a pair of Jacks. Moreover, a Straight from 9 to K will have equal pay as a straight from 3 to 7.

Hand Ranking

Royal Flush – A straight flush begins at 10 and ends with an Ace.

Straight Flush – Five consecutive cards in value of the same suit.

Four of a Kind – Four identical cards

Full House – Three identical cards accompanied by a pair

Flush – Five cards of the same suit

Straight – Five consecutive cards in value

3 of a Kind – Three identical cards

Two Pair – Two pairs in the final 5-card poker hand
